Overview
Uber is hiring a Head of Compliance Operations for EMEA Delivery to define the vision and roadmap for operational compliance. You'll work cross-functionally to manage compliance risks and establish operational controls. This role requires strong leadership and strategic planning skills.
Job Description
Who you are
You have extensive experience in compliance operations, ideally within a complex and regulated environment. Your background includes defining compliance strategies and managing operational risks effectively across multiple regions. You possess strong leadership skills and the ability to work cross-functionally with various teams to achieve compliance objectives. You are adept at translating regulatory obligations into actionable operational controls, ensuring that compliance is maintained at all levels of the organization. Your communication skills are exceptional, allowing you to build relationships with local and regional regulatory bodies and internal stakeholders alike. You thrive in strategic roles where you can influence compliance frameworks and drive alignment across diverse teams.
What you'll do
As the Head of Compliance Operations for EMEA Delivery, you will define the strategic vision and roadmap for operational compliance in the region. You will build and maintain a Compliance Management Framework that proactively identifies, manages, and mitigates compliance risks across all local areas and countries. Your role will involve establishing a single source of truth for key operational compliance obligations and metrics, driving the mitigation of operational gaps. You will serve as the central point of contact for operational compliance, ensuring alignment across local, regional, and global functions. Additionally, you will build connections with local and regional regulatory bodies to optimize operational compliance controls and balance risk effectively. Your leadership will be crucial in fostering a culture of compliance within the organization, ensuring that all teams understand and adhere to regulatory requirements.
